Question
Complete the sentence. All of the following are parts of the conceptual structure of the TOGAF Architecture Governance Framework, except ______
Options
- AContent
- BContext
- CProcess Flow Control
- DRepository
- EVision

Explanation
The TOGAF Architecture Governance Framework has a conceptual structure composed of four parts: Content (the artifacts and deliverables subject to governance), Context (the environment and policy landscape governing the architecture), Process Flow Control (the mechanisms and processes that enforce governance), and Repository (the store of governance-related artifacts and records). 'Vision' is not one of these structural components - in TOGAF, 'Vision' is the output of Phase A (Architecture Vision) in the ADM, which is a separate concept. This is a common distractor because the Architecture Vision is prominent in TOGAF, but it is not part of the Governance Framework's conceptual structure.
